The Roundhouse music venue in London has issued a public apology after alleged antisemitic imagery was displayed during a Primal Scream concert. The incident occurred when graphics appeared on stage showing the Star of David entwined with a swastika as the band performed their song Swastika Eyes. The venue stated that the images were shown without their knowledge and expressed deep regret and condemnation of the display, emphasizing their commitment to inclusivity and safety.
Jewish community organizations have reported the band to the police and called for an urgent investigation into how the incident occurred. The imagery has been widely criticized for its offensive nature, with campaigners describing it as a clear breach of the international definition of antisemitism. Primal Scream and the police have been approached for comment as the venue pledges to ensure such acts do not happen again.
